Our time perception is logarithmic, which means our lives are subjectively half over by age 20, if we are to die at 80. The way we perceive 10-20 is the same as 20-40, or 40-80. On a bright note, you'd have to waste time until your mid 30s to equal that "wasted time" in your teenage years (subjectively), but you've already taken steps against that this early on!
